Understanding the terminology related to catastrophic injury claims can help you navigate the legal process more confidently. Terms such as liability, damages, negligence, and settlement are frequently used throughout your case. This section provides clear explanations of these key concepts.
Liability refers to the legal responsibility one party holds for causing harm or injury to another. In catastrophic injury cases, establishing liability is crucial to securing compensation from the at-fault party.
Damages are the monetary compensation awarded to an injured party for losses suffered due to the injury. These can include medical expenses, lost wages, rehabilitation costs, and compensation for pain and suffering.
Negligence is the failure to exercise reasonable care, resulting in harm to another person. Proving negligence is a fundamental aspect of many personal injury and catastrophic injury cases.
A settlement is an agreement reached between parties to resolve a dispute without going to trial. Settlements can provide compensation more quickly and with less uncertainty than court proceedings.

In California,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im, including catastrophic injury cases, is generally two years from the date of the injury. It is important to act promptly to preserve evidence and protect your legal rights. Delaying the filing of a claim can result in losing the ability to seek compensation. Consulting with an attorney soon after your injury can help ensure your case is filed within the required timeframe.

Workplace catastrophic injuries may be covered under workers’ compensation laws, which have specific procedures and benefits. However, in some cases involving third-party negligence, you might also have the option to pursue a personal injury claim outside of workers’ compensation. It is important to consult with legal counsel to understand your rights and the best course of action based on the circumstances of your injury.

Many catastrophic injury attorneys work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they receive payment only if you win your case. This arrangement helps ensure access to legal representation without upfront costs. It’s important to discuss fee structures and any potential expenses during your initial consultation to understand your financial obligations clearly.
